Savaria Co. (TSE:SIS) Plans Monthly Dividend of $0.04

Savaria Co. (TSE:SIS – Get Free Report) declared a monthly dividend on Monday, April 22nd, Zacks reports. Stockholders of record on Tuesday, April 30th will be paid a dividend of 0.043 per share on Friday, May 10th. This represents a $0.52 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 3.08%. Seoul International School's music education enhances cultural awareness

Julia Ji-yeon Kim, the head of the performing arts department at Seoul International School (SIS), discussed the advantages and trends in music education, the history of the music program at SIS and her vision for its future, in an interview with The Korea Times.

Communist Party's security chief to visit Russia ahead of Putin's expected China trip as law enforcement ties grow

Chen Wenqing, who oversees police and intelligence, will go to Moscow for international security meeting a month after terror attack rattles Russia and ahead of anticipated visit by Vladimir Putin to mark 75th anniversary of diplomatic relations.
